Indonesia is famously superstitious ( pemali or taboos). Consequently, horror is the highest-grossing genre in local cinema. On YouTube and TikTok, "Horror POV" videos thrive. Creators dress as Kuntilanak (female vampire ghost) or Genderuwo (hairy ape-like spirit) and scare delivery drivers. Alternatively, they film "exploring abandoned hospitals in West Java." These videos routinely rack up 10–20 million views because they tap into a cultural truth: in Indonesia, the supernatural is always just a step away.
